Georgia Tech, Atlanta,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Georgia Tech?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Georgia Tech 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,101 | $1,362 | $7,500 |
| Georgia Tech 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,256 | $1,700 | $8,500 |
| Georgia Tech 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,783 | $2,350 | $5,450 |
| Georgia Tech 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,035 | $750 | $8,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Georgia Tech
What type of rentals are currently available in Georgia Tech?
There are currently 265 Apartments for Rent in Georgia Tech, GA with pricing that ranges from $789 to $23,976. There are also 147 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Georgia Tech ranging from $600 to $8,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Georgia Tech?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Georgia Tech ranges from $600 to $8,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,022.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Georgia Tech?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Georgia Tech range from $875 to $18,230,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,700 to $8,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,350 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$789.
